The Shift from Paper to Portals

For years, physicians and surgeons were needed to navigate a maze of physical documentation, notary signatures, and snail-mail correspondence to get the right to practice in a particular jurisdiction. Today, the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B) and different state-level entities have modernized this procedure.

By using digital repositories, doctors can now save their qualifications-- including medical school records, evaluation ratings, and postgraduate training records-- in a central "digital vault." When a doctor seeks to "purchase" or spend for a new license in a different state, they can advise these centralized systems to beam their validated data straight to the state board, decreasing the timeline from months to weeks.

Secret Platforms for Digital Licensure

To effectively browse the digital licensing landscape, health care experts must communicate with a number of essential companies. These entities act as the "digital stores" where licenses are looked for, paid for, and managed.

  1. The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B): This is the umbrella company that offers the core digital facilities for all 70+ state and territorial medical boards in the United States.
  2.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S): A vital service for those looking to improve their digital profile. FCVS produces an irreversible, verified portfolio of a physician's core qualifications.
  3. Uniform Application (UA): A web-based application that allows physicians to "buy" or apply for licenses in multiple getting involved states without re-entering their data for each single board.
  4.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C): A contract amongst getting involved U.S. states to substantially speed up the digital licensing process for physicians who certify.

The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C)

The IMLC represents the peak of the "purchase digitally" motion in healthcare. Given that its creation, the Compact has actually allowed physicians who hold a complete, unlimited license in a "State of Principal Licensure" (SPL) to obtain licenses in other member states practically instantaneously.

When the preliminary background check is completed by the SPL, the doctor simply selects the guest states they want to practice in and pays the requisite charges through the IMLC website. The licenses are usually issued within a couple of organization days, making it the most efficient digital procurement method readily available today.

Step-by-Step: How to Secure a License Digitally

For a physician all set to expand their practice footprint, the digital application journey normally follows this sequence:

Phase 1: Preparation of the Digital Profile

The doctor starts by creating an account with the FSMB and initiating an FCVS profile. This is where the core "primary source" documentation is gathered and vetted.

Stage 2: Choosing the Pathway

The applicant should decide if they are applying to a single state through that state's particular portal or making use of the IMLC for multi-state access.

Phase 3: The Uniform Application

The candidate completes the Uniform Application (UA), which populates their professional history. This digital type is then e-signed and submitted.

Stage 4: Payment of Fees

The "purchasing" phase: The applicant pays the state board application charges, the confirmation charges, and any processing costs through a protected charge card or ACH deal.

Phase 5: Monitoring and Issuance

Using a digital control panel, the candidate tracks the "checklisted" products as they are gotten by the board. When all green checks appear, the board issues a digital license certificate, and the physician's name is upgraded in the state's public verification database.

2. How much does a digital medical license expense?

Expenses vary significantly by state. Most application fees v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500. Additionally, services like the FCVS charge a cost for credential verification, and if using the IMLC, there is a ₤ 700 processing cost plus the individual state fees.

3. How long does the digital process take?

For states within the IMLC, a license can be obtained in just 5-- 10 days. For basic digital applications through state portals, the procedure typically takes in between 30 and 90 days, depending on the board's work.

4. Can global medical graduates (IMGs) use these digital websites?

Yes, IMGs can utilize the FCVS and the Uniform Application. However, they should likewise have their ECFMG (Educational Commission for Foreign Medical Graduates) accreditation confirmed digitally and may face additional documents requirements.

5. Does a digital license permit for telemedicine?

Yes. Getting a license digitally through a state board grants the same practice rights as a physical license, consisting of the capability to deal with patients by means of telemedicine within that state's jurisdiction.
